And when we say under 24 hours, we’re also talking way under 24 hours.... Web11 apr. 2024 · You can marinate chicken breasts for as little as 15 minutes up to 5 hours. Dark meat chicken holds up in a marinade better, so try marinating it from 2 hours to 12 hours. If you are using bone-in chicken or thicker chicken breasts, you should marinate them longer. Thinner and boneless chicken pieces don’t need to marinate as long.

The shelf-life of chicken Web15 mei 2024 · You can marinate chicken in lemon juice for up to 2 hours before it starts to break down. Some recipes will call for a shorter period of marination, while some will require the full 2 hours, but you will not find many that suggest marinating chicken for longer. Over-marinated chicken will turn rubbery or mushy and unpleasant.
